Manufacturing Engineer (Composites)
SpaceX is a company focused on developing technologies for human life on Mars. They are seeking a Manufacturing Engineer in the Composites Test group to develop efficient equipment and processes to support new structures and components.

Responsibilities
Create test stand, equipment, and process concepts
Create fabrication drawings, wiring schematics, and instrumentation lists
Design and analyze structures, fluid systems, and mechanisms
Collaborate with a multidisciplinary team (design, build, and reliability engineers) to ensure new designs are streamlined for efficient manufacturing
Supervise the integration of test stands and equipment including fabrication, mechanical assembly, and data/control systems
Operate test stands with great attention to detail (tests have very little margin for error, so attention to detail is a crucial and essential characteristic of a development test engineer)
Develop manufacturing processes, and write detailed technical instructions to ensure hardware follows highest possible processing standards
Refine existing hardware and procedures for existing products based on lessons learned and product changes
Collaborate with highly skilled technicians to evaluate and resolve non-conformances by creating actionable items that systematically improve reliability and eliminate root causes
Manage several priorities and projects at the same time
